Program Overview

Offered by the Faculty of Law and International Relations, this program prepares students to analyze global political structures and international issues such as diplomacy, global security, human rights, and regional cooperation. Students study world history, political theory, international law, global economics, and strategic communication. Through simulation exercises, policy debates, and case studies, they develop negotiation, research, and policy-writing skills. Graduates gain a strong foundation for careers in diplomacy, NGOs, media, and governmental or international organizations.

Admission Requirements

General Admission Requirements

  • Valid PassportRequired

    Must be valid for at least 6 months beyond your intended period of stay.

  • Recorded InterviewRequired

    A video interview must be completed through our online admission portal. The interview will be recorded and reviewed by the university admission committee.

  • High School DiplomaRequired

    A high school diploma or equivalent certificate is required.
